Wal-Mart Shows Modest Sales Spike

Wal-Mart Stores Inc. said sales at stores open at least a year rose only 2.3 percent in December, as weakness at its Sam’s Club warehouse unit and a slow start to the holiday season dragged on results.

Feds Put Usury Limit in Legal Limbo

If Arkansas? constitutional restriction on usury wasn?t problematic enough, a recent change in the Federal Reserve?s monetary policy has left the state without a clear definition of the allowable interest rate that can be charged by non-bank lenders.

Taxes on Display

The Arkansas Department of Finance and Administration says the now defunct Taylor Displays Inc. owes back sales taxes to the state of Arkansas totaling $357,186.03.

AWA Spreads West

Athletic World Advertising has leased the 30th floor at Tulsa?s CityPlex Towers, the tallest building in Oklahoma, for an expansion that will add 40 new sales positions there.
